Abstract

Perfeccionamientos en los sistemas para la mezcla de flujos secos y húmedos en enfriadores atmosféricos mixtos, con flujos de aire paralelos que comprenden un cuerpo de intercambio térmico húmedo y un cuerpo de intercambio térmico seco, dispuestos en paralelo en el flujo de aire, comprendiendo el sistema para la mezcla de los flujos secos y húmedos unas superficies de deflexión de los flujos de aire seco dispuestas corriente abajo de los cuerpos de intercambio térmico, caracterizados porque dichas superficies de deflexión están constituidas por lo menos por un canal (12,14,18) abierto en dirección de la salida de aire del enfriador y que se extiende en el espacio (11,25) situado corriente abajo del cuerpo de intercambio térmico húmedo (5) y corriente abajo del cuerpo de intercambio térmico seco (10,24), estando dicho canal dirigido, a partir de la región del lugar de llegada del flujo de aire húmedo a nivel del cuerpo de intercambio seco que es más próximo a este último, hacia el centro delenfriador.
